This Internal Spray Coating Production Line is a high-precision, automated solution specifically engineered for applying uniform functional coatings to the internal and external surfaces of furniture panels and molded pulp products.
For furniture panel applications, the system utilizes reciprocating spray technology with multiple guns to ensure even coverage on flat panels, cabinet doors, and decorative boards. It handles various substrates including solid wood, MDF, particleboard, and composite materials.
For molded pulp packaging (such as eco-friendly food containers, trays, and tableware), the machine employs advanced rotary/spin-coating technology. Each product is securely held on a custom-engineered fixture while precision nozzles dispense coating. The centrifugal force created by spinning ensures the liquid coating spreads evenly across all complex interior geometries, including deep corners and sidewalls, creating a seamless barrier.
The process is ideal for applying waterproof, oil-proof, high-temperature resistant (exceeding 100°C), and surface hardening coatings that meet stringent food safety standards. By automating the application, the line guarantees consistent coating weight (typically 5-50 microns), eliminates manual errors, and significantly reduces material waste with coating utilization reaching nearly 100%.
The system is designed for 24/7 continuous operation and is fully customizable to handle various product shapes, sizes, coating materials (water-based, UV, PU), and production speeds.

Q: What is the difference between spray coating and spin coating for molded pulp?
A: Spray coating uses compressed air to atomize coating; spin coating uses centrifugal force for even distribution on complex shapes. Our lines can be customized with either technology based on your product requirements.
Q: Can this line handle different product shapes on the same production line?
A: Yes. The key is customizable fixtures. Changeover between products involves swapping fixtures and loading a different PLC recipe, completed in minutes.
Q: What types of coatings can be applied?
A: The system is compatible with water-based acrylics, PU varnishes, UV-curable coatings, PFAS-free oil-barrier coatings, and bio-polymer films. Fluid path components can be customized for specific viscosities.
Q: How is coating thickness controlled?
A: Thickness is controlled by programmable parameters: spray pressure, rotational speed, conveyor speed, and material viscosity. All parameters stored in PLC for repeatability (5-50 microns range).
